Technical Specifications

Ensure your system meets these requirements for optimal performance and security

Operating Systems

  • Windows 10, 11 (64-bit)
  • macOS 10.13 High Sierra or later
  • Linux (Ubuntu 18.04+, Debian 10+, Fedora 32+)

System Requirements

  • Processor: 1 GHz or faster
  • RAM: 2 GB minimum (4 GB recommended)
  • Storage: 100 MB available disk space

Supported Browsers

  • Google Chrome 90 or later
  • Mozilla Firefox 88 or later
  • Microsoft Edge 90 or later
  • Safari 14 or later (macOS only)
  • Brave Browser 1.24 or later

Compatible Wallets

  • Trezor One (all firmware versions)
  • Trezor Model T (all firmware versions)
  • Trezor Safe 3 (latest model)
  • Trezor Safe 5 (upcoming support)

Additional Notes

USB Connection: Requires a free USB port for connecting your Trezor hardware wallet. USB 2.0 or higher recommended for best performance.

Internet Connection: Active internet connection required for blockchain synchronization and transaction broadcasting.

Firmware Updates: Keep your Trezor device firmware updated to ensure compatibility with the latest Bridge version.

Security Software: Some antivirus or firewall software may require configuration to allow Trezor Bridge connections.

Installation Guide

Follow these step-by-step instructions to install Trezor Bridge on your system

1

Download the Installer

Click the download button above or visit the official Trezor website to download the latest Windows installer (.exe file). The file size is approximately 15 MB.

2

Run the Installer

Locate the downloaded file in your Downloads folder and double-click to run it. Windows may display a security warning - click 'Run anyway' or 'More info' then 'Run anyway'.

3

Follow Installation Wizard

The installation wizard will guide you through the process. Accept the license agreement and choose your installation directory. We recommend using the default location.

4

Complete Installation

Click 'Install' and wait for the process to complete. This usually takes less than a minute. Once finished, Trezor Bridge will automatically start in the background.

5

Verify Installation

Open your web browser and navigate to wallet.trezor.io. Connect your Trezor device via USB. The website should automatically detect your device if Bridge is running correctly.

Troubleshooting Tips

  • If installation fails, temporarily disable your antivirus software
  • Ensure you have administrator privileges on your Windows account
  • Check that no other cryptocurrency wallet software is running
